Hello Samsung family! To help you get the best performance from your device, here are some essential tips I’ve found really useful:
1. *Clear cache regularly:* Cached data can slow down your phone. Go to Settings > Storage > Cached data and clear it occasionally.
2. *Keep your software updated:* Always install the latest system and app updates. They come with performance improvements and bug fixes.
3. *Manage background apps:* Close apps running in the background that you’re not using to save RAM and battery life.
4. *Use Device Care:* Samsung’s built-in Device Care feature optimizes your phone with a single tap. Use it regularly to boost speed and battery.
5. *Avoid overcharging:* Try not to leave your phone charging overnight to prolong battery health.

Its not always advisable to close background apps especially those that you use often as they consume more battery to open them up again.
The modern phone has an advanced battery that regulates itself when charging even overnight. There are settings that predict your phones usage and charges your battery as and when it should based on your lifestyle.
Restarting your phone once a week should be enough to keep your device running like it should.
